In this episode of The Art of Being Well, I sit down with my friend Karena Dawn for one of the most heartfelt and profoundly human conversations we’ve had on this podcast. Karena opens up about growing up with a mother who lived with paranoid schizophrenia, the instability and fear that shaped her childhood, and the decade of darkness that followed - marked by depression, drug misuse, and feeling disconnected from herself and her future.

She shares the moment that became her turning point: a clinic doctor who prescribed sunshine and yoga instead of medication. From there, movement, therapy, journaling, and meaningful community slowly helped her rebuild her identity and reclaim her life.

We also talk about the powerful role vulnerability played in her healing, the forgiveness she cultivated toward both of her parents, and the final years she cared for her mother through illness and decline. Karena’s story is a testament to resilience, compassion, and the ability to rewrite the narrative you inherited.

We also discuss the evolution of Tone It Up, why she ultimately bought back the company, and her mental health nonprofit, The Big Silence Foundation. This episode is an important reminder that healing is nonlinear - and that telling the truth about your story can be one of the most transformative things you ever do.

A few of my favorite things we cover in this episode: 

  • Karena’s childhood navigating a mother with paranoid schizophrenia and repeated missing-person episodes
  • The decade of darkness: depression, drug misuse, escape behaviors, and teenage suicidality
  • The turning point: a clinic doctor prescribing sunshine and yoga instead of medication, sparking her healing
  • How running, triathlon training, and movement rebuilt her confidence and identity
  • Rebuilding spirituality after trauma and returning to a sense of connection and meaning
  • The healing power of vulnerability, journaling, and storytelling
  • Karena’s path to founding Tone It Up and how she rebuilt it after private equity challenges
  • Caring for her mother during the final five years of her life and the role of diet, environment, and support
  • Isolation, mental illness, forgiveness, and what she learned about compassion
  • The Big Silence Foundation and its mission to destigmatize mental health and provide access to therapy
